How it works

From the user side, the workflow begins with an instruction, source material, project context, or other input supported by the product. Users describe an image in natural language and can refine results through prompt changes, variations, reference images, composition choices, and style-oriented controls. The platform generates candidate images that are selected and iterated rather than edited only through traditional pixel tools. The result can then be reviewed, regenerated, edited, or passed into the next stage. In practice, iteration with clearer context and constraints matters more than expecting a perfect first output.

Features

Features

Text-to-image generation

Turns written scene descriptions into original images, giving users a fast way to explore compositions, subjects, environments, and stylistic directions.

Image references

Reference images can guide aspects of a generation, making it easier to communicate composition, mood, subject characteristics, or aesthetic intent than text alone.

Variations and iterative refinement

Users can branch from a promising output and continue refining rather than restarting every concept from zero, which suits exploratory design work.

Web and Discord workflows

The product can be used through its supported interfaces, allowing creators to choose the interaction style that best fits their existing workflow.

Style-oriented controls

Prompting and creative controls are designed to make visual style a first-class part of generation, which is one reason the tool is popular for concept and mood exploration.

Use cases

Use cases

01
Concept art exploration

A game or film artist can test environments, costumes, props, or mood directions before committing production time to detailed manual artwork.

02
Campaign visuals

A marketer can generate distinctive hero concepts for a campaign, then select a direction for further design work, typography, and brand adaptation.

03
Editorial illustration

A publisher or independent creator can explore metaphorical or stylized imagery for articles, newsletters, covers, and social posts when stock imagery feels generic.

04
Moodboards and visual development

A designer can create a coherent set of references around a product, space, character, or theme to align collaborators before formal production begins.

Frequently asked questions

Frequently asked questions

Where do creators access Midjourney to generate visual artwork?+

Midjourney primarily operates through Discord channels and direct messages, as well as a dedicated web interface for eligible users. Users submit descriptive text prompts, apply parameters, and interact with generated image grids using interactive buttons.

What editing controls are available for refining generated images in Midjourney?+

Midjourney provides inpainting tools to modify selected image areas, pan and zoom controls to expand canvas boundaries, and style reference parameters. Creators can also vary regions subtly or strongly to explore aesthetic variations from initial concepts.

Can images produced by Midjourney be utilized commercially?+

Paid subscribers generally receive commercial usage rights for the images they create, subject to platform terms of service. Free trial tiers and specific corporate revenue thresholds may have distinct licensing conditions that users should verify.
